What does ugh mean in texting?

‘Ugh’ is an expression used to represent an exasperation or a feeling of annoyance. It is used in texting to express dissatisfaction, frustration or irritation, especially in response to a situation.

It can be used as part of an expression such as “Ugh, that’s so annoying!” or as a stand-alone response to show that the recipient of the text shares in the sender’s negative emotions. In some cases, it can also be used to express sarcasm.

Is ugh a negative word?

Yes, ugh is generally viewed as a negative word. It is an interjection that is used to express distaste, displeasure or dissatisfaction. It is often used when something is difficult, undesirable or annoying.

Ugh is also used to express annoyance when someone’s requests or demands seem unreasonable or when a situation is annoying or uncomfortable. It can also be used sarcastically as a more restrained version of saying “Yeah, right!

Why do we say ugh?

Ugh is an interjection often used to express disgust, frustration, or boredom. It is often accompanied by a facial expression and body language that conveys the same sentiment. The origin of the term is unclear, but it is believed to be an intentional onomatopoeia for the sound that people make when showing their displeasure.

What are words like ugh called?

The word “ugh” is often referred to as an interjection. An interjection is a word that expresses emotion or surprise, and can stand alone in a sentence. Examples of other interjections include “oops,” “ah,” “hey,” and “wow.”

What is the name of filler words?

Filler words are a type of speech placeholder used to fill pauses in conversations. They are also known as discourse markers, discourse fillers, conversational fillers, hesitation markers, and pause fillers.

They are typically non-lexical items such as uh, um, ah, like, right, okay, so, and you know. Filler words are used to fill space while the speaker is thinking, regrouping their thoughts, or searching for the right word or phrase to use.

They are used to indicate acknowledgement and agreement, and can indicate that the speaker is about to continue with their original thought or start a new one.

What are very rare words?

Very rare words are words or phrases that are used infrequently or that are difficult to understand and not commonly found in daily life. These words are usually the result of a specialized field or interest and are not often encountered by the average person.

They may be highly specific technical terms, archaic or obsolete words, regional dialectical phrases, or words that only exist in a certain language. Examples of very rare words could include: ‘fuscous’ (dark brown color), ‘hypodorian’ (mode in ancient Greek music), ‘uxorious’ (excessively devoted to one’s wife), ‘erinaceous’ (resembling a hedgehog), and ‘illimitable’ (limitless).
